A group of students sold 84 candles in 4 hours. At what unit rate were the candles being sold

Mathematics
2 answers:
lys-0071 [83]3 years ago
7 0
The candies are being sold at a rate of 21 candies per hour
nikklg [1K]3 years ago
3 0
21 candles per hour
84/4=21
